Date:  February 27, 2026 to February 28, 2026

📣 Now announcing the 2026 Natchez Literary and Cinema Celebration! February 27 – February 28, 2026 at The Natchez Convention Center!

We are proud to unveil the theme of this year’s literary festival: Stories of American Freedom.

This powerful and timely theme invites readers to explore the diverse and ever-evolving definitions of freedom in American life—past and present. The 2026 NLCC will weave a diverse tapestry of the stories that make us who we are as Americans today. These are stories of hope and resilience, stories of perseverance and bravery, stories of ordinary people who took a stand and fought hard for the freedoms that we enjoy today.

Join us as we spotlight authors from across the South and beyond who capture the complexity of American freedom—its struggles, triumphs, contradictions, and hopes for the future.

Through the lectures of expert historians and prolific authors, we’ll honor the patchwork of stories that make up our nation’s pursuit of freedom for all.
